For a florist in Waterville, the build order that actually matters:

  1. Hours, address and one-tap directions in the first screenful. This is the single most requested piece of information.
  2. A current, readable menu or stock list as real text — not a photographed PDF that Google cannot read and phones cannot zoom.
  3. Fast image loading. Your photography is the product, and it is worthless if it arrives after the visitor has gone.

Websites that win florists more customers

Flowers are bought quickly, emotionally, and usually late — which makes an honest same-day delivery cutoff one of the most valuable things on a florist website. We build custom florist websites with online ordering, delivery zone and cutoff logic, occasion-based collections, and a separate wedding and event inquiry path. Hand-coded for Lighthouse 100 speed and optimized for "flower delivery" and occasion searches. Real photography of your own arrangements replaces stock images, because customers order what they can see you actually make. One flat fee, no monthly platform fees. Serving Waterville, Maine.

Generic stock bouquets and a vague delivery promise lose the order to the national wire service that stated a cutoff time.
